.claude/skills/database/indexing-strategy/SKILL.md
Optimiser les requêtes SQL avec des index. Utiliser quand une requête est lente ou lors de la création d'un schéma.
npx skillsauth add FRmicrow/dataFootV1 indexing-strategyInstall this skill globally with one command. Works with Claude Code, Cursor, and Windsurf.
3 of 9 scanners reported clean
Some scanners were skipped, did not run, or reported a non-clean status. Review each row below.
Servez-vous de cette compétence lorsque les requêtes deviennent lentes ou lors de la conception initiale pour anticiper les besoins de performance.
Dans une table customers fréquemment filtrée par email et triée par created_at, créez un index composite (email, created_at).
Les index ne peuvent pas compenser une mauvaise conception de schéma ; ils doivent être utilisés en complément d’une bonne normalisation.
development
Écrire des tests unitaires Node.js. Utiliser quand on teste une fonction isolée avec Vitest dans backend/test/.
testing
Tester l'intégration entre services. Utiliser quand on vérifie l'interaction contrôleur/service avec Supertest + Vitest.
development
Tester les composants React avec Vitest + Testing Library. Utiliser quand on teste le rendu ou les interactions.
testing
Écrire des tests end-to-end Playwright. Utiliser quand on teste l'application complète du point de vue utilisateur.